Web Designer

Back-end Developer

About Me

I'm a web designer + developer based out of Toronto, ON. My formal education is in Computer Science and Math, but I have the added passion for user-centered design. Currently, I enjoy building with the Symfony2 framework on the backend, paired with Sass + Foundation on the frontend.
Over the course of my career, I've worked at a variety of companies, from startups in the medical field, to enterprise firms, to mobile game studios. This breadth of experience has provided me the opportunity to learn a large variety of technologies and to work with a bunch of fantastic people.

My Designs



Hackworks is a startup based in Toronto that organizes hackathons. The website features an online hackathon management system, which handles accounts, registration, waitlists, teams, and submissions for our clients.
Hackathons Near Me

Hackathons Near Me

Hackathons Near Me is a tool I built with AngularJS that, as you'd expect, helps people find hackathons near them. The data is also visualized in a nifty little map.
Gradient Animator

Gradient Animator

Gradient Animator is a CSS generator used to create animated backgrounds, with the option to export as a GitHub gist. It was inspired by MailChimp's Email Design Guide.


ShopFiller is a tool I wrote to help people get free shipping on Amazon. It uses Amazon's Product Advertising API to automatically search for items that qualify for free shipping. It also has a Chrome Extension and a FireFox Add-On.
Scotiabank Hack IT

Scotiabank Hack IT

Scotiabank Hack IT is a hackathon that was hosted by Scotiabank in February, 2016. It was Scotiabank's first hackathon and offered $25,000 in prizes.


TrafficJam is a hackathon that was hosted by Evergreen Cityworks and the City of Toronto in October, 2015. The website also serves as a template for a "basic" hackathon website for future Hackworks events.


The Canadian Open Data Experience (CODE) is a nation wide hackathon sponsored by the Government of Canada. Participants create websites or mobile apps that utilize data sets from Canada's Open Data Portal.

Project Giants

Project Giants is the working title for the upcoming game being developed by XMG Studio. I worked in tandem with their art team to create this teaser site.

I've Worked With

  • HTML5
  • Sass + CSS3
  • Foundation
  • Bootstrap
  • jQuery
  • Angular.js
  • Ember.js
  • PHP + Symfony2
  • Ruby on Rails
  • PHPUnit
  • MySQL
  • PostgreSQL
  • Oracle
  • MongoDB

More About Me

I was born in Calgary, AB, grew up in PEI, and am now living in Toronto, ON. Outside of work, my interests include reading (Dune), watching classic films (Hitchcock), and eating Sneaky Dee's nachos. I also enjoy watching hockey, but the Leafs are too damn expensive. Some day I hope to see The Smiths, but for now, Johnny Marr was pretty great.

Get In Touch

Sent! I'll get back to you shortly.
Please fill out your name.
Please enter a valid email.
Please fill out your message.